MANILA, Philippines — Three persons died while three others were injured after a blaze hit a three-story residential building in Barangay Concepcion Uno, Marikina City on Thursday morning, according to the Bureau of Fire Protection (BFP).

The BFP said the fire broke out in the building along E. Santos Street cor. Cepeda Street at around 8:05 a.m.

The incident was raised to the first alarm at 8:11 a.m.

It was brought under control by 8:30 a.m. and was declared fully extinguished at 9:44 a.m..

The BFP said the fatalities are a 55 year old male, a 23 year old and 18 year old female.

Among the injured were Ronel John Jarlego, 29, and Stacey Anne Jarlego, 6, who sustained first-degree burns on their upper bodies.

Meanwhile, Sid Andrei Jarlego, 4, suffered an abrasion on his left elbow.

The BFP said around 60 individuals were displaced by the fire.

Estimated damage to property is P100,000.

Six fire trucks, two rescue trucks, and two ambulance units were deployed to the area.

The cause of the fire is still under investigation.
